The Anatomy of a Downpour: Why Rain Isn’t Just Free Water
It’s a common misconception that rain is pure. As it passes through our atmosphere, it picks up various bits and bobs that your filtration system must then deal with.
Dilution Dilemma
Heavy British thunderstorms can rapidly drop an inch or two of water, diluting your carefully balanced chemicals. Sanitiser levels decline, making water more vulnerable to bacterial growth.
Atmospheric Pollution & Acid Rain
Rainwater is naturally slightly acidic because it absorbs carbon dioxide as it falls. In industrial or urban areas of the UK, it can also emit nitrogen and sulphur oxides. When this water enters your pool, it can cause your pH and Total Alkalinity to plummet, resulting in stinging eyes and, over time, corroded heat exchangers or ladders.
The Garden Runoff Effect
Many UK pools are bordered by dense gardens or stone coping. Heavy rain not only enters the pool directly but also carries runoff from the surrounding land. This runoff includes:
- Organic Matter: Grass clippings, soil, and sodden leaves enter the pool.
- Fertilisers: If you’ve recently applied fertiliser to your lawn, rain can transport nitrates and phosphates into the pool, effectively feeding algae.
- Algae Spores: Wind and rain are the primary means of transport for algae spores seeking a new home.
Temperature Drops
Unlike the Mediterranean, a cold snap often follows a British rainstorm. A quick influx of cold rainwater can drop your pool temperature considerably, forcing your heat pump or boiler to work overtime, which can be a bit of a sting when the utility bills arrive.
Your Post-Storm Checklist
Once the clouds clear and the birds sing, it’s time for damage control. Follow these steps for a crisp Monday swim.
Clear the Debris
Don’t rely just on the mechanical cleaner. Use a leaf skimmer net to quickly remove large organic matter. Check the skimmer and pump strainer baskets; clogged baskets reduce circulation, making recovery harder.
Test the Water (The Non-Negotiable Step)
Use your testing kit or strips. Your levels have likely shifted. Prioritise them as follows:
- pH & Alkalinity: Do these first. If pH is off, chlorine won’t work well.
- If chlorine drops below 1.0 ppm, add more immediately.
Shock the System
After a particularly heavy or dirty storm, a dose of Oxidising Shock (non-chlorine or calcium hypochlorite) will help remove any organic contaminants brought in by the rain. This resets the water and prevents unwanted colour changes for up to 48 hours.
Manage the Water Level
If the rain is particularly heavy, the water level may be above the halfway point of the skimmer mouth. If it rises too high, the skimmer cannot remove surface debris properly. Use the waste or backwash setting on your multiport valve to lower the level to the correct height.
Run the Filter
Run the pump for at least 24 hours after a storm to mix chemicals and filter fine silt.
